Julia Margaret Urban born June 2, 1927 died January 25, 2024. A Port Chester Resident for over 65 years.
Predeceased by her husband Robert Joseph Urban; parents Francis David Andrews and Mary Emiliy VerNooy; and her sisters Dorothy Ruth Hennessy and Ethel Elizabeth Hyatt.
Survived by her children: Janet Frances Gomolson and husband Andy Stofko and her son Joseph John Kele (and husband Jeremy); Jean Urban Spadaccia and her daughters Meredith Regan Spadaccia (and husband Woody Batts) and Jennifer Marie Spadaccia; Robert Michael Urban and wife Deborah and sons Robert Anthony Urban (and wife Jenna) and Nicholas James Urban; and John (Ben) David Andrews Urban and wife Karen and their sons Michael Jonathan Urban (and wife Brittany), Matthew Robert Urban (and wife Mackenzie), Mark Alexander Urban (and girlfriend Samatha) and Mitchell Terrance Urban (and fiancee Anna)
Julie grew up in Ellenville, NY. She is a descendant of William Brewster (the Minister on the Mayflower) and several Revolutionary War soldiers.
Julie met her husband Robert while attending Syracuse University as part of the U.S. Cadet Nursing program. They married on Jan 1 1948. She got her Nursing Degree in 1947 and later returned to college to get her Bachelors from Pace University in 1983.
She was a nurse at Port Chester’s United Hospital for over 40 years, a long time member of Summerfield Methodist Church in Port Chester until they closed their doors in 2012 and an active member of Rye Brook’s Senior Center for over 30 years until Covid shut down everything in 2020.
She was known for her caring of others, kind smile and always being thankful for everyone and everything around her. She enjoyed working puzzles, playing bridge and playing rummikub.
